Posted onApr 2, 2026
Guest User
The hotel is located in the Old Town, which was great for watching the Holy Week processions, but it could get a bit noisy, so closing the windows was a must. The front desk staff provided excellent and warm service, which was a big plus. It's a pretty economical and good value-for-money option. However, transportation can be a bit inconvenient, especially with large luggage, as the streets aren't very easy to navigate and public buses don't reach the area. During Holy Week, the roads were even closed, making it tricky to get back to the hotel at night. On the bright side, it's close to many restaurants and attractions. Getting to Plaza de España by car or on foot takes about 20-30 minutes.

Frequently asked questions

What is the average price of a hotel in Seville for this weekend?

According to the latest 12-month data from Trip.com, the average price for a 3-star hotel in Seville this weekend is SEK 3,012 per night. For a 4-star hotel, the average cost is SEK 3,075 per night. If you're looking for a luxury experience, 5-star hotels in Seville this weekend typically cost SEK 6,606 per night.

How much do hotels in Seville cost per night during weekdays?

Based on the latest 12-month data from Trip.com, the average price for a 3-star hotel in Seville during weekdays is SEK 2,240 per night. For a 4-star hotel, you can expect to pay around SEK 2,320 per night. If you're seeking a luxury stay, 5-star hotels in Seville generally cost SEK 6,067 per night on weekdays.
